I'm the idiot I'll, start off with that. I replaced a radiator hose that was getting a little thin in one spot from rubbing on some piping from my procharger, so I go to tighten the petcock so I can put the coolant back in and I end up snapping the darn thing right off!!! I wasn't paying attention and just way over tightened it, I've never done this before. My question is does the petcock unscrew all the way out, or is there a way to get it completely out or do I need a new radiator?

I'm actually quite surprised they still put a pet-**** on the rads. I haven't looked at mine but, all the same, that's pretty nice of Ford.
Anyway, was it just the "handle" that you twisted off? That's quite common. You shouldn't need a new rad regardless. I will have to look at mine and see what is involved. If it is like days gone by, it should be threaded into the rad. A 1/2 inch line wrench will prolly take it out.
